Artificial Neural Networks Modeling of Heat Transfer Characteris-tics in a Parabolic Trough Solar Collector using Nano-Fluids

In the current article, an experimental investigation has been implemented of flow and heat transfer characteristics in a parabolic trough solar collector (PTSC) using both nano-fluids and artificial neural networks modeling. Water was used as a standard working fluid in order to compare with two different types of nano-fluid namely, nano-CuO /H2O and nano-TiO2/ H2O, both with a volume concentration of 0.02. The performance of the PTSC system was eval-uated using three main indicators: outlet water temperature, useful energy and thermal efficiency under the influence of mass flowrate ranging from 30 to 80 Lt/hr. In parallel, an artificial neural network (ANN) has been proposed to predict the thermal efficiency of PTSC depending on the experimental re-sults. An Artificial Neural Network (ANN) model consists of four inputs, one output parameter and two hidden layers, two neural network models (4-2-2-1) and (4-9-9-1) were built. The experimental results show that CuO/ H2O and TiO2/H2O have higher thermal performance than water. Overall, it was veri-fied that the maximum increase in thermal efficiency of TiO2/H2O and CuO/H2O compared to water was 7.12% and 19.2%, respectively. On the oth-er hand, the results of the model 4-9-9-1 of ANN provide a higher reliability and accuracy for predicting the Thermal efficiency than the model 4-2-2-1. The results revealed that the agreement in the thermal efficiency between the ANN analysis and the experimental results about of 91% and RMSE 3.951 for 4-9-9-1 and 86% and RMSE 5.278 for 4-2-21.

Experimental Study of Parabolic Trough Receiver with Perforated Twisted Tape Insert Using Fuzzy Model Analysis

A solar water heating system has been fabricated and tested to analyze the thermal performance of Parabolic Trough Solar Collector (PTSC) using twisted tape insert inside absorber tube with twisted ratio about TR=y/w=1.33. The performance of PTSC system was evaluated by using three main important indicators: water outlet temperature (Tout), useful energy and thermal efficiency (ηth) under the effect of mass flow rate (ṁ) ranges between 0.02 and 0.04 Kg/s with the corresponding of Reynolds number (Re) range (2000 to 4000). In a parallel, a fuzzy-logic model was proposed to predict the thermal efficiency (ηth) and Nusselt number (Nu) of PTSC depending on the experimental results. The fuzzy model consists of five input and two output parameters. The input parameters include: solar intensity (I), receiver temperature (Tr), water inlet temperature (Tin), water outlet temperature (Tout) and water mass flow ( ) while, the output include the thermal efficiency (ηth) and Nu. The final results indicate that, owing to the mixture of the swirling flow of the perforated twisted-tape insert, the perforated twist tape insert enhances the heat transfer characteristics and the thermal efficiency of the PTSC system. More specifically, the use of perforate twist tape inserts enhanced the thermal efficiency by 4% to 4.5% higher than smooth absorber tube. Also, the predicted values were found to be in close agreement with the experimental counterparts with accuracy of ~92 %. So, the suggested Fuzzy model system would have high validity and precision in forecasting the success of a PTSC system compared to that of the traditional model. Pace, versatility, and the use of expert knowledge for estimation relative to those of the traditional model are the advantages of this approach

Decision Making in Materials Selection: an Integrated Approach with AHP

Materials selection is a multi-criteria decision-making (MCDM) problems because the large numberof factors affecting on decision making. The best choice of available material is critical to thecompetitiveness and success of the manufacturing organisation. The analytical hierarchy process(AHP) is an important tool to solve MCDM problems. The choosing process of suitable material(such as a refrigerant fluid) for the Air Condition System (ACS) is faced with challenges such aslack of a systematic approach in setting the optimal performance in terms of its impact on theenvironment and operation. Selecting process for the one refrigerant from a range suitable ofsuitable refrigerant is complex process. The study presents a comparative performance analysisof ACS for using four alternative refrigerants R290, R410, R404 and R22. Then, one of these suitablerefrigerant is selected. The comparison is based on three criteria system operation, environmentand maintenance.Novels ACS performance assessment model is proposed based on an analytical hierarchy process(AHP). The model is based on two main criteria of ACS, quantitative criteria, cooling capacity(CC), coefficient of performance (COP), etc.).And qualitative criteria (Ozone Depletion Potential (ODP), Global Warming Potential (GWP) andmaintenance cost (MC)). It is necessary to look for new technique help decision making to selectalternative refrigerants, to fulfill the goals of the international protocols (Montreal and Kyoto)and optimum operation, to satisfy the growing worldwide demand, in addition the increase outdoortemperature in some countries.This study provides a developed methodology for evaluating ACS performance. Moreover, it helpsto select a robust decision. The results obtained from AHP process that the best rank of the suitablerefrigerant was R404 (0.3763) followed by R22 (0.3657) and so on for the other. Therefore,the proposed methodology can help the decision maker to select the best alternative for bothcriteria (qualitative and quantitative) in complex selecting process.

Fuzzy Reliability-Vulnerability for Evaluation of Water Supply System Performance

The reliability of water supply system is a critical factor in the development and the ongoing capability to succeed in life and people's health. Determining of its, with high certainty, for performance of water supply system is developed to ensure the sustainability of system. Reliability (Re) plays a great role in evaluation of system sustainability. The probability approaches have been used to evaluate the reliability problems of systems. The probability approach is failed to address the problems of reliability evaluation that comes by subjectivity, human inputs and lack of history data. This research proposed two models; I) traditional model: fuzzy reliability measure suggested by Duckstein and Shresthaand then developed by El-Baroudy; and II) developed model: fuzzy reliability-vulnerability model. The two models implemented and evaluation of water supply system by using two hypothetical systems (G and H). System (G) consists of a single pump and System (H) consists of a two parallel pumps. Triangular and trapezoidal membership functions (MFs) are used to investigate of the reliability measure to the form of the membership function. The results agree with expectations that the reliability of parallel component system {ReH (0.53)} is higher than the reliability of single component system {ReG (0.47)}. Moreover, the result by using fuzzy set reduces the effect of subjectively in process of decision-making (DM). The fuzzy reliability vulnerability is able to handle different fuzzy representations and different operation environment of system
